Safeguarding Your Information in a Hyperconnected World
In today's digitally driven environment, safeguarding your tech data assets is paramount. Cyber threats are constantly evolving, posing a significant risk to individuals and organizations alike. From phishing scams, malware infections, and data breaches, the potential consequences of falling victim to cybercrime can be devastating.
To mitigate these risks, it's crucial to adopt robust cybersecurity practices. Implement strong passwords, keep your software up to date, and be cautious about clicking on suspicious links. Additionally, consider using multi-factor authentication for added security.
By understanding the nature of cyber threats and taking proactive steps to protect yourself, you can improve your online security posture and minimize the risk of falling victim to cybercrime.
